You’ll be an all-in-one B2B marketing master focusing on creating snappy, persuasive marketing content!

Your Day to Day:

  • Writing is a big part of what you’ll do. You’ll write email copy, blog posts, social media posts, webinar invites, case studies and more.
  • Set up an email marketing campaign in Marketo. Publish a blog post in WordPress.
  • Promote new materials on LinkedIn. Get engagement.
  • Keep a finger on the pulse of industry trends and compile weekly newsletters.
  • Participate in team meetings, subject matter expert interviews, and campaign brainstorms.

What you need to know about the Calgary Tech Scene

Employees can spend up to one-third of their life at work, so choosing the right company is crucial, not just for the job itself but for the company culture as well. While startups often offer dynamic culture and growth opportunities, large corporations provide benefits like career development and networking, especially appealing to recent graduates. Fortunately, Calgary stands out as a hub for both, recognized as one of Startup Genome's Top 100 Emerging Ecosystems, while also playing host to a number of multinational enterprises. In Calgary, job seekers can find a wide range of opportunities.
